Plumbing Demands of a Bidet

Bidet Plumbing DemandsBecause bidets have mixing shutoffs comparable to taps that permit you to change the rinse water to a comfy temperature level, another demand is both a hot and cold-water supply. In addition, the pipes code requires what’s called a “vacuum breaker” to be used with bidet supplies.

Vacuum breakers stop water from being siphoned back into the supply system and causing contamination. A lot of bidets have an integral vacuum breaker, but it’s smart to confirm this before you buy your bidet. If one is doing not have, as opposed to standard shut down at the wall surface, you can buy ones that have a vacuum cleaner breaker.

An additional difference between mounting a bidet and mounting a toilet is the size and setup of the waste line. W.c.s have internal traps to prevent drain gases from running away into occupied spaces. Bidets do not, and a trap needs to be mounted in the rough pipes below| the floor. Also, since bidets are used for washing just and not for solid waste, their drains are commonly just 1 1/2 inch in diameter, contrasted to the 3-inch drainpipe pipes most w.c.s make use of. Actually, the drainpipe setting up for a bidet is much more like that for a shower or bathtub than a toilet.

Setting up Wall- and Floor-Mounted Bidets

Wall-mounted bidets need an unique frame to be mounted in the wall surface before drywall and floor tile. Mounting screws connected to this frame protrude from the wall surface, and all the pipes links are made at the wall surface. An unique drainpipe connection is used that seals when the drainpipe from the bidet is pushed in. The drainpipe of a floor-mounted bidet is always in the floor, but the supplies may appear of the floor or the wall surface. In every instance, it is essential to evaluate the pipes layout in the bidet’s installation guidelines and make certain the harsh pipes is precisely where it’s expected to be.

With the floor and wall surfaces completed and the quit shutoffs mounted on the rough pipes supplies, you can begin to really install the bidet now. The area of a wall-mounted system is determined by the previously mounted screws.

Floor-mounted units are fastened using hanger screws, which have a lag string on one end and a machine string on the various other. Find and predrill the holes for these screws using a template (if one is provided) or by positioning the bidet so its drainpipe hole straightens with the trap and drain in the floor.

Because installation procedures vary for different bidets, ensure to check out the supplier’s guidelines before you begin. In most cases, it’s much easier to set out and install supply lines before placing the bidet to wall surface or floor.

Wall-mounted bides are more difficult to install after that floor-mounted models. Some wall-mounted units have unique hardware that threads onto the screws before the bidet is placed, while others simply make use of nuts and washing machines. In either instance, you’ll be supporting the bidet from above while protecting the placing screws by feel from below. As you’re putting the bidet on the screws, the drainpipe needs to be lined up with that in the rough pipes, and whatever is pushed home simultaneously. An assistant can make a difference below.

Floor-mounted bidets are positioned over the screws you‘ve threaded into the floor and held back with nuts and washing machines, much like a toilet. The drainpipe setting up is placed into the hole in the bidet from above, and the drainpipe links are tightened up using an access hole in the back of the bidet.

The last actions are attaching the versatile supplies to the shutoffs. Check for leaks, repair any kind of you might discover, and afterwards caulk the bidet to the wall surface or floor with a cool grain of silicone sealant.

The Bidet Seat Choice

Electric Bidet Seat If you do not have area for a dedicated system, a bidet-seat for your toilet is an option. There are 2 usual grabs. First, bidets make use of more water than w.c.s do, so standard 3/8-inch toilet shutoffs have to be replaced with 1/2-inch ones. This might need understanding how to solder pipe. Second, since there won’t be a hot water supply at the toilet, bidet-seats have indispensable electrical heaters. There requires to be a GFCI-protected electrical outlet close by.

If you have those points, after that the installation refers eliminating the existing toilet seat and mounting the base for the bidet-seat in its location. Water is connected to the base from the shut-off via an adaptable supply, and the heater is plugged in.

After that, the bidet seat is placed to its base according to that supplier’s guidelines.

What is a Bidet, Japanese Toilet, Washlet, Shower Toilet or Smart Toilet?

At its simplest, a bidet is a bowl-shaped seat with taps to clean after using the toilet. A bidet can obtain you cleaner than toilet tissue and is much more eco-friendly than various other techniques. Bidets can be placed on your floor or wall surface, and some w.c.s have integrated bidets or toilet seats with bidet features. A traditional bidet is made from ceramic and designed to be straddled, with the individual facing the back of the component.

Toilets with Integrated Bidets

A fairly new component on the marketplace is a toilet featuring an integrated bidet. As opposed to a separate toilet and bidet or a toilet with a seat that functions as a bidet, these are w.c.s with added features integrated.

Just like the bidet toilet seats, you can discover a toilet with an integrated bidet with several features. Some are standard, using simply the water spray, while others have incorporated MP3 players, heated seats, deodorizers, and much more. They are not as usual as the various other options and expense substantially much more, around $1,000 – $1,200, but they install like a basic toilet and do not need as much area. They need a neighboring electrical outlet to operate, however.

Benefits and drawbacks of a Bidet

Many people appreciate using a bidet and the ease it brings. There is no demand for toilet tissue with a bidet. So, you have lower regular monthly costs, do not need to fret about the eco-friendly effect of paper, and might have fewer toilet blockages. Bidets are considered much more hygienic by some and give a personalized experience in the lavatory.

Nevertheless, bidets take up a great deal of area. Every bidet requires a minimum of 30 inches, with 36 inches being the advised quantity. It additionally requires to be mounted near the toilet for best use, and the toilet additionally requires 30 to 36 inches. For a tiny washroom, adding a bidet might need major renovations. Also in larger shower rooms, it might mean moving cabinets or various other pipes to better fit the bidet.

Bidets are simple to clean and preserve. The ceramic is easily wiped down with a towel and washroom cleaner. Because the bidet does not take care of solid waste, it is simple to maintain clean and much less most likely to stain.

Bidet toilet seats can additionally be wiped down with a soft, moist towel as needed. Often, a bidet seat or spray blockages from hard water. If this occurs, saturate the nozzle in vinegar to dissolve the blockage and flush with clean water.
